SANTA set up his grotto in a Wisbech primary school as a memorable Christmas Fair raised almost �900.

Parents and children filled the classrooms of Orchards Primary School for the Fair, which boasted a host of stalls and activities.

Youngsters played ‘hook a duck’, ‘play your cards right’ and ‘frog hoopla’ before visiting Santa and his winter helpers.

Cakes and refreshments were served and a Christmas raffle boosted the fundraising total, with prizes donated by Fenland businesses.

The school thanked all the guests and volunteers who helped raise the final total of �890, calling the event a “huge success”.
